摘要
The Internet of Things (IoT) comprises heterogeneous and interconnected objects. It tries to provide information anytime, anywhere and for anything. The IoT incorporates a variety of technologies, mainly the Wireless Sensor Networks (WSNs). In such networks, sensors are deployed in an open and unprotected environment. Their role is essentially to supervise the environment and report real life phenomena. Only trusted and accurate data should be exchanged between sensors and transmitted to the fusion node which will take charge of the extraction of reliable information. To reach this purpose, we propose that trust should be established at three levels. In this paper, we provide a survey on recent advances in data perception trust (trust in the raw sensed data), communication trust (trust relationship between sensors) and data fusion trust (trust in the fusion process). Moreover, we investigate the existing research to identify their challenges and to suggest future research prospects. (C) 2019 Elsevier B.V. All rights reserved.
